Output c81123b3c866361c9e63ed7239d4a06c00ea21db980dfa1ebaa7ce6d0459933a:9

value
810343
script pubkey
OP_0 OP_PUSHBYTES_20 09087fc895f7a6b401b52e3fed486cd463c5efec
address
bc1qpyy8ljy477ntgqd49cl76jrv633utmlvses0uq
transaction
c81123b3c866361c9e63ed7239d4a06c00ea21db980dfa1ebaa7ce6d0459933a
spent
true